Chelsea want to sign Leeds United keeper Illan Meslier in the summer.
Graham Potter wants to sign a new keeper in the summer, and Meslier is high on their wish list.
The 23 year old recently became the youngest goalkeeper to have played 100 Premier League games.
Tottenham Hotspur and Manchester United have also been linked with a move for the Frenchman, but Chelsea believe they can out-bid them, as they have with a number of high profile players recently.
Édouard Mendy has refused to sign a new contract with the West London club, and he could well be sold when the transfer window. Whilst Kepa Arrizabalaga wore the captain’s armband against Everton on Saturday, he has yet to convince Potter that he should be the long-term number one. Meslier was initially signed on loan from Ligue 1 side in Lorient in 2019, but they picked up their option to make the move permanent.
